// SPDX-License-Identifier: GPL-2.0-or-later OR MIT
#include "mt7621.dtsi"
#include <dt-bindings/gpio/gpio.h>
#include <dt-bindings/input/input.h>
/ {
compatible = "zyxel,wsm20", "mediatek,mt7621-soc";
model = "Zyxel WSM20";
aliases {
led-boot = &led_system_white;
led-failsafe = &led_system_red;
led-running = &led_system_white;
led-upgrade = &led_system_red;
label-mac-device = &gmac0;
};
chosen {
bootargs-override = "console=ttyS0,115200n1";
};
leds {
compatible = "gpio-leds";
led_system_white: led-0 {
gpios = <&gpio 3 GPIO_ACTIVE_LOW>;
label = "white:system";
};
led_system_red: led-1 {
gpios = <&gpio 4 GPIO_ACTIVE_LOW>;
label = "red:system";
};
led-2 {
gpios = <&gpio 8 GPIO_ACTIVE_LOW>;
label = "green:led1";
};
led-3 {
gpios = <&gpio 0 GPIO_ACTIVE_LOW>;
label = "white:led2";
};
led-4 {
gpios = <&gpio 13 GPIO_ACTIVE_LOW>;
label = "green:led3";
};
led-5 {
gpios = <&gpio 17 GPIO_ACTIVE_HIGH>;
label = "red:led4";
};
led-6 {
gpios = <&gpio 5 GPIO_ACTIVE_HIGH>;
label = "white:led5";
};
};
keys {
compatible = "gpio-keys";
led {
label = "led";
gpios = <&gpio 16 GPIO_ACTIVE_LOW>;
linux,code = <KEY_LIGHTS_TOGGLE>;
};
reset {
label = "reset";
gpios = <&gpio 6 GPIO_ACTIVE_LOW>;
linux,code = <KEY_RESTART>;
};
wps {
label = "wps";
gpios = <&gpio 18 GPIO_ACTIVE_LOW>;
linux,code = <KEY_WPS_BUTTON>;
};
};
};
&nand {
status = "okay";
partitions {
compatible = "fixed-partitions";
#address-cells = <1>;
#size-cells = <1>;
partition@0 {
reg = <0x0 0x100000>;
label = "Bootloader";
read-only;
};
partition@100000 {
reg = <0x100000 0x100000>;
label = "Config";
};
partition@200000 {
reg = <0x200000 0x1c0000>;
label = "Factory";
read-only;
nvmem-layout {
compatible = "fixed-layout";
#address-cells = <1>;
#size-cells = <1>;
eeprom_factory_0: eeprom@0 {
reg = <0x0 0xe00>;
};
precal_factory_e10: precal@e10 {
reg = <0xe10 0x19c10>;
};
macaddr_factory_1fdfa: macaddr@1fdfa {
compatible = "mac-base";
reg = <0x1fdfa 0x6>;
#nvmem-cell-cells = <1>;
};
macaddr_factory_1fdf4: macaddr@1fdf4 {
reg = <0x1fdf4 0x6>;
};
};
};
partition@3c0000 {
reg = <0x3c0000 0x2800000>;
label = "firmware";
compatible = "fixed-partitions";
#address-cells = <1>;
#size-cells = <1>;
partition@0 {
label = "kernel";
reg = <0x0 0x800000>;
};
partition@800000 {
label = "ubi";
reg = <0x800000 0x2000000>;
};
};
partition@2bc0000 {
reg = <0x2bc0000 0x2800000>;
label = "Kernel2";
};
partition@53c0000 {
reg = <0x53c0000 0x100000>;
label = "persist";
};
partition@54c0000 {
reg = <0x54c0000 0x400000>;
label = "rootfs_data";
read-only;
};
partition@58C0000 {
reg = <0x58c0000 0x25c0000>;
label = "app";
read-only;
};
partition@7e80000 {
reg = <0x7e80000 0x100000>;
label = "crt";
read-only;
};
};
};
&gmac0 {
nvmem-cells = <&macaddr_factory_1fdfa 0>;
nvmem-cell-names = "mac-address";
};
&gmac1 {
status = "okay";
label = "wan";
phy-handle = <&ethphy0>;
nvmem-cells = <&macaddr_factory_1fdf4>;
nvmem-cell-names = "mac-address";
};
&ethphy0 {
/delete-property/ interrupts;
};
&pcie {
status = "okay";
};
&pcie1 {
wifi@0,0 {
compatible = "mediatek,mt76";
reg = <0x0000 0 0 0 0>;
nvmem-cells = <&eeprom_factory_0>, <&precal_factory_e10>;
nvmem-cell-names = "eeprom", "precal";
mediatek,disable-radar-background;
#address-cells = <1>;
#size-cells = <0>;
band@0 {
reg = <0>;
nvmem-cells = <&macaddr_factory_1fdfa 1>;
nvmem-cell-names = "mac-address";
};
band@1 {
reg = <1>;
nvmem-cells = <&macaddr_factory_1fdfa 2>;
nvmem-cell-names = "mac-address";
};
};
};
&pcie2 {
status = "disabled";
};
&switch0 {
ports {
port@1 {
status = "okay";
label = "lan3";
};
port@2 {
status = "okay";
label = "lan2";
};
port@3 {
status = "okay";
label = "lan1";
};
};
};
&state_default {
gpio {
groups = "i2c", "uart3", "jtag", "wdt";
function = "gpio";
};
};
